Description
Crusty on the outside and chewy on the inside, this artisan-style bread requires only 10 minutes of preparation and tastes as if it came from a bakery.
Ingredients
US|METRIC
14 SERVINGS
- 3 1/4 cups all purpose flour (for bread)
- 1 3/4 tsp. salt
- 1 tsp. granulated sugar
- 3/4 tsp. active dry yeast
- 1 1/2 cups warm water
- all-purpose flour (for work surface)

Directions
- Stir together the flour, salt, sugar, and yeast in a large mixing bowl. Create a well in the center and add the warm water. Stir forcefully with a wooden spoon until the ingredients combine into a ragged dough.
-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and set aside in a warm place to rise for 6-10 hours.
- Preheat the oven to 425°F. Line a Dutch oven with a sheet of parchment paper.
